What is a Cryptocurrency Casino?
A cryptocurrency casino is an online gaming platform that accepts digital currencies for deposits, withdrawals, and gameplay. Unlike traditional online casinos that depend on f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, GBP) and traditional banking systems, Crypto Casino's casinos make use of the speed, security, and privacy of blockchain technology.
While some platforms act as "hybrid" sites-- accepting both fiat and Crypto Online Casino--"crypto-native" casinos operate exclusively on the blockchain, typically moving away from conventional KYC (Know Your Customer) processes to prioritize user privacy.

2. Provably Fair Technology
Among the most ingenious functions of the blockchain-based betting sector is "Provably Fair" video gaming. This innovation enables players to validate the randomness and fairness of every hand, spin, or dice roll utilizing cryptographic hashes. Rather of counting on a third-party audit, players can validate that the casino has actually not controlled the odds.

4. What does "Provably Fair" imply?"Provably Fair" is a set of algorithms that enable players to verify that the outcome of a video game was not predetermined by the casino. It provides mathematical evidence that the video game was fair.
